rihe l. d.. Geier Emmy, Eleve, @hier a corporation of @hilo applicants ama it, ion, serai nu. ,trarre it c., (ci. 11a-rai 'The invention relates to suction cleaners and more particularly to the smaller sizes of the.
same, commonly called hand cleaners, which are sumciently light enough in weight that they may i be conveniently carried by an operator, in one hand, and so used for cleaning or dusting draperies, curtains, blankets, mattresses, pillows, walls,
` furniture, upholstery, pictures, higly polished surfaces, and the like. l@ A serious objection to the hand type cleaner is that the usual hard metal Wall of the fan and/or motor housing contacts with the 'surf ace on which the machine is laid, or over which the machine is operating. Thus, when such a cleaner is used w for dusting highly polished surfaces and the like, or when the cleaner is used in the vicinity of the same, such surfaces frequently are scratched, marred or dented by the hard metal walls.
Accordingly it is an object of the present in vention to provide a soft, non-abrasive, yielding guard or foot-rest member for a hand cleaner, which supports or maintains the metal parts' of the same in spaced relation from the surface hen ing cleaned, or upon which the cleaner is laid, for
preventing the cleaner from scratching or marring such surfaces.
A hand cleaner usually is electrically operated and accordingly is equipped with a power supply wire cord which leads through the metal motor mi housing Wall to the motor therein. It ls therefore necessary to supplement the cord insulation with an insulating bushing for the opening in the metal motor housing Athrough which the cord passes.

that lt cannot be pulled or jerked loose from the motor connections therefor, during use, as when the cord extending to a power socket is snagged or caught on a piece of furniture or the like.
Also, it is desirable if not necessary to prevent the cord from being sharply bent or flexed during use,.at or adjacent the place where it passes through the motor housing, to avoid damage or injury to the cord at that place.
` M And nally, it is essential to manufacture hand cleaners as' simply, and inexpensively as possible,
so that the cleaners will have a very low selling price to the purchaser.
It is therefore a further object of the present invention to provide a hand oleane'.` with a combined one-piece foot-rest and cord anchor, guard and insulating bushing member made of a. homogeneous, insulating, wear-resisting, non-abrasive, soft, resilient, yielding material.
N The nozzle of a hand cleaner is usually formed Moreover, it is desirable to anchor the cord so of al :mi cast integrally with thefan housing thereof. Such a metal nozzle during use frequently scratches, mars, or dents a highly polished surface, which is being cleaned or dusted by the cleaner, and may dage upholstery by use of a metal nozzle directly thereon.
Moreover, it has been found that aluminum is charactermed by the fact that it rubs od on light colored fabrics or the lilre by contact therewith and produces stains, streaks or spots thereon. 55 Thus, when a hand cleaner having an aluminum nozzle is used for olea light colored curtains, it frequently leaves dart: discolorations thereon, in being passed baci; and forth over 'the fabric.
Accordingly, it is a further object of the present mi invention to provide a hand cleaner with a nozzle de of a homogeneous, Wear-resisting, nonabrasive, soft, resilient, yielding material to avoid scratching highly polished surfaces being cleaned, to avoid staining, streaking or spotting light 755 colored materials being cleaned, and to avoid damage to upholstery and the lilre.
These and other .objects y be attained by provig a construction, a preferred embodiment of which is hereter described in detail and shown in the drawing', which may be stated 'n general terms as including a suction cleaner havn ing a motor and metal motor housing, and a fan and metal fan housing, a nozzle member made of a non-abrasive, wear-resisting, soft, yielding ma- 85 terial preferably rubber, connected to the metal fan housing,l and a combined one-piece foot-rest and cord anchor, guard and insulating bushing member made of an insulating, non-abrasive, wear-resisting, soft, yielding material also pref- ,W erably rubber, connected to the metal 'motor housing..

A hand type suction cleaner is shown in Fig.
l, which includes walls forming a motor housl for 1m tor t, and walls forming the u@ fan housing 6. A fan 'Z is mounted for rotation within the fan housing 6 on the shaft of the motor 5. Rotation of the fan 7 causes air cur rents to be drawn into the nozzle 8, and into the chamber formed by thefan housing d, the air currents then being exhausted through the fan chamber exhaust outlet 9 and into and through the dust bag 10, which y be provided with an opening, closed by any suitable *me 11, for emptying the contents of the bag there= through.
The motor housing e and fan housing d preierably constitute two separate al castings connected together by any suitable m 12, and the same are provided with a handle 13 tor carrying and manipulating the clee The nozzle 8 is made oil a non-abrasive, w-n isting, soit yielding material, which is prei= "y molded rubber, sothat a cleaner equipped cfith euch a nozzle may be used to clean or dust highly polished surfaces Without danger oi marring, denting or scratching the ec rihe lip walls 8c and ab are preferably provided with an internal recess 2e in which. is poE sitioned a strip metal loop 25 for reinforcing; the rubber lip walls against collapse when the cleaner is being operated. A brush 2t is preierably provided on the rear lip wall 8b, by riv-s eti the same at 27 through the wall to the loop 25. A
d, nozzle made oi soft yielding mate, as distinguished from the usum cast al i n: nozzie, cannot damage upholstery in cl am., the same.
In addition, a nozzle made of soft rubber does not have any tendency to dirty, streak, or soil the material being cleaned, as is the case with the usual nozzle made of aluminum. Moreover, the use oi-a molded rubber nozzle enables d cleaners to be attractively made with appe color combinations, which render the same more salable.
And finally, the usual cast aluminum nozzleA must have its outer surface polished, while a molded rubber nozzle is not required to be polished and the same may be made and assembled on a suction -c-leaner fan casing much more inexpensively than a vacuum cleaner having a'polished aluminum nozzle. Y
The improved combined foot rest and cord anchor guard and insulating bushing member generally indicated at 14 is also made of an insulating, non-abrasive, wear-resisting, soft, yielding material, also preferably molded rubber. Such a. rubber foot-rest member cooperates with the rubber nozzle 8 to form a soft, non-abrasive support for the vacuum cleaner fan and motor housing so that the use of the hand cleaner will not subject polished surfaces to the liability of being scratched, dented. marred, or otherwise damaged.
- The particular design of the foot-rest member 14 is important,`and preferably includes a base portion 15 having a cylindrical bushing portion 16 extending upwardly integrally therefrom, the bushing portion being provided with an annular recess 17 adjacent its upper end. A tubular cord guard portion 18 extends outwardly from one side of the base portion 15, the tubular passageway 19 therein .communicating with an enlarged angularchamber or bend 20 provided in the base portion 15 and terminating in a slightly tapered tubular passageway 21 through the bushing portion 16.
'I'heangleAbetweentheaxisofthewbular nordsee y. r- 11 19 and 21 is preferably less than a right angle, while the cross sectional area of the chamber 2U is greater than the cross sectional areas of the passageways 19 and 21, for reasons which will be hereinafter described.
Referring to Fig-.2, the wire cord 22 may be readily inserted through the communicating passages 19, 20 and 21 of the foot-rest member 14 by inserting a free end of the cord wire through the openings in the direction indicated by an arrow in Fig. 2, the chamber 29 being 4enlarged in cross section to 'facilitate inserting the cord wire therethrough. The wire ends may then be suitably connected to the terminals of the motor 5 so that the motor may be operated when a plug connected to the other end of the cord wire 22 is electrically connected to a suitable source of power.
In view of the fact that the member le is made oi' soit, insulating, yielding n'iaterial, the bushing portion 16 thereof may then inserted through an openmg 23 provided in a lower wall of the motor casing e, so that the wall 4 will he resiliently engaged in the annular recess 17 ot the bushing portion 16, as shown. in Fig. 3, in. which the bushing portion 16 is for all practical purposes substantia-ily permanently connected to the motor housing Wall fi, and insulates the wires oi the cord 22 therefrom.
the parte are assembled in the position in Fig. 3, a pull cn the cord 22 in the direc tion. shown by the arrow in caueee the iiex ibly bent portion 22' thereof to snugly hug the relatively 51:.: t upper angular corner 20 of the base member chamber 20.
Since the foot-rest member 14 is formed of a soit, yielding material, and since the angle A is less than a right angle, the cord 22 and angular corner 20 bind each other so as to substantially peently anchor the, cord in the foot-rest member against being pulled out, which would cause the wires of the cord 22 to be loosened from their connections with the terminals of the motor 5.
The walls of the tubularguard portion 18 of the foot-rest member 14 are flexible, but yet thick enough that the cord 22 cannot be sharply ilexed or bent. For these reasons, successive bending or flexing forces to which the cord 22 is always subjected in use will not result in injuring, breaking, wearing through, or short-circuiting the wires thereof at or adjacent the place where it passes through the motor housing wall 4, as may he the case with suction cleaner' cords which are not equipped with the present improvement.
And nally, the non-abrasive and wear-resisting character of the material of which the footrest member 14 is made prevents the same from scratching, marring, or otherwise injuring surfaces over which the cleaner may be passed, and always maintains the metal parts thereof in spaced relation from such surfaces.
